Polycarbonate Glycol (PCG) is a polymer compound synthesized by chemical reaction, usually polymerized by carbon dioxide, epoxy compounds or carbonate derivatives and diols (such as ethylene glycol, propylene glycol, etc.) under the action of catalysts. Its molecular structure contains repeated carbonate groups (-O-CO-O-) and hydroxyl groups (-OH) at both ends, combining the rigidity of polycarbonate and the reactivity of diols.

Polycarbonate diol has excellent flexibility, low-temperature impact resistance and biocompatibility, and can react with isocyanate compounds to form polyurethane materials. Due to its stable chemical properties, it is widely used in polyurethane elastomers, thermoplastic polyurethanes (TPU), polyurethane foams, adhesives and sealants.

In recent years, PCG has attracted much attention due to its green synthesis route that can use carbon dioxide as a raw material, and has shown great potential in biomedical engineering (such as tissue engineering scaffolds) and degradable plastics. As a chemical intermediate that is both functional and sustainable, polycarbonate diol has promoted the development of high-performance materials and green chemistry.

Market development opportunities and main driving factors

The development opportunities of the polycarbonate diol market mainly come from the promotion of environmental protection policies, the growth of downstream industry demand and the drive of technological innovation. With the global emphasis on sustainable development, polycarbonate diol has attracted much attention due to its green synthesis path that can use carbon dioxide as raw material. The rapid development of downstream industries such as automobiles, electronic appliances, construction and packaging has provided a broad application space for polycarbonate diol. In addition, technological innovation has continuously optimized the production process of polycarbonate diol and gradually reduced the cost, further promoting the growth of market demand.

Risks facing the market

The risks faced by the polycarbonate diol market mainly include fluctuations in raw material prices, risks of technological substitution and intensified market competition. The instability of raw material prices may lead to rising production costs and affect the profitability of enterprises. At the same time, with the continuous emergence of new materials, polycarbonate diol may face the risk of being replaced. In addition, intensified market competition may lead to price wars, further compressing the profit margins of enterprises.

Downstream demand trends

In terms of downstream demand trends, the application of polycarbonate diol in polyurethane elastomers, thermoplastic polyurethanes (TPU), polyurethane foams, adhesives and sealants will continue to grow. The increasing demand for high-performance materials, especially in the automotive and electrical and electronic industries, has driven the development of the polycarbonate diol market. In addition, with the rapid development of biomedical engineering and degradable plastics, polycarbonate diols have shown great application potential due to their biocompatibility and degradability.
